The Fulbright U.S. Student Program has the mission of promoting mutual understanding and cooperation between nations of the world by offering research, graduate study and English teaching opportunities in over 140 countries to graduating seniors, graduate students, and alumni. The program currently awards approximately 2,000 grants annually in all fields of study and operates in more than 140 countries worldwide. Applicants must be a U.S. citizen or U.S. national. The OSU Campus Deadline for the Fulbright Program is in early September and the National Deadline is in October annually.
